On a split 5-4 vote, Loudoun County supervisors on July 12 approved plans for a 424-acre mixed-use development that will accompany a minor league baseball park near the intersection of routes 7 and 28.

Weider Global Nutrition Moves Global Headquarters to Phoenix
PHOENIX, AZ–(Marketwire – July 12, 2010) – Weider Global Nutrition, a health and wellness nutrition company, has moved its global corporate headquarters to Phoenix, Ariz., a business climate favorable to existing employees and attracting new talent in all areas of operations.
